As cities continue to experience rapid urbanization and growing population densities, the demand for efficient and secure parking management solutions has surged. This paper focuses on developing an advanced automated parking system designed to address the complexities of urban transportation. The system leverages cutting-edge technologies to optimize parking operations in high-demand locations, such as shopping centers and metro stations. Specifically, it adapts the YOLO model for real-time vehicle detection and incorporates an EasyOCR model for precise license plate recognition. By automating toll and parking fee collection, the system enhances efficiency, lowering the traffic congestion usually connected to conventional parking systems and the requirement for manual supervision. Additionally, security measures are integrated to detect and prevent the use of fraudulent license plates, thereby boosting overall safety. Users will also benefit from real-time notifications that provide updates on parking space availability, streamlining their parking experience. This paper also aligns with sustainability goals by minimizing vehicle emissions caused by prolonged searches for parking spaces and reducing idle times. It aims to optimize operational workflows, ultimately improving urban mobility. Implementing this automated parking management system marks a significant step toward realizing the broader vision of smart cities, enhancing the quality of life in urban environments.
